In my bathroom I have / had 2x Heatmiser neaStat-2 V2 controllers and 1x Heatmiser neoHub Gen 2 Wi-Fi gateway which allows them to be controlled on-line.
One Heatmiser neaStat-2 V2 was for UFH and I have now replaced this with a W500. It was only controlled by a floor temperature probe and the W500 works great.
The second Heatmiser neaStat-2 V2 controls an electric towel rail element which acts as an on/off switch based on time and does not use any temperature input at all.

I’m now looking to convert setup the second Heatmiser neaStat-2 V2 that controls the electric towel rail element to Aqara and needing some advice.

What would be the most appropriate device and setup to control the electric towel rail element? T2 Relay? Another W500? Something else?

Hello, judging by the picture you are from England (sockets in the bathroom are prohibited). A T2 (T1) relay will suit you, the dryer does not have a powerful load tag. You can use a wireless button as a control tool. I described controlling the dryer by time in my lesson. Automation 2.0, lesson 6, bathroom automation on a working example
